[App][Pro] Sofar (Release 1.1.45, Test 1.1.46)

@Adrian_Rockall 60hz - now 60.05Hz

hi,

yes 60hz, may vary to 60.06hz this morning

I have just checked and the app should accept up to 65Hz and I see from the log that you are using an older version. Could you install the test version as that should fix the issue.

i only find version 1.1.24 on homey app store

Did you follow the link above?

hello @Adrian_Rockall ,
i have installed the 1.1.28 test version and * 2025-04-17T22:12:49.737Z Frequency 59.95 is not valid

60.01 is not valid also

  • 2025-04-17T22:12:44.070Z
    ************** App has initialised. ***************

  • 2025-04-17T22:12:44.084Z
    2025-04-17T22:12:44.084Z [log] [ManagerDrivers] [Driver:battery] BatteryDriver has been initialized

  • 2025-04-17T22:12:44.089Z
    2025-04-17T22:12:44.089Z [log] [ManagerDrivers] [Driver:grid] GridDriver has been initialized

  • 2025-04-17T22:12:44.093Z
    2025-04-17T22:12:44.093Z [log] [ManagerDrivers] [Driver:solar_panel] SolarPanelDriver has been initialized

  • 2025-04-17T22:12:44.097Z
    2025-04-17T22:12:44.097Z [log] [ManagerDrivers] [Driver:summary] InverterDriver has been initialized

  • 2025-04-17T22:12:49.248Z
    Found Inverter: IP: 192.168.0.38, S.No: 2768796139

  • 2025-04-17T22:12:49.252Z
    Checking register 14 for grid frequency:

  • 2025-04-17T22:12:49.257Z
    send_request: start = 14, end = 14, fc = 3

  • 2025-04-17T22:12:49.532Z
    No MODBUS data to process data

  • 2025-04-17T22:12:49.538Z
    Returned null.

Checking register 1156 for grid frequency:

  • 2025-04-17T22:12:49.542Z
    send_request: start = 1156, end = 1156, fc = 3

  • 2025-04-17T22:12:49.729Z
    Data received: {
    ā€œtypeā€: ā€œBufferā€,
    ā€œdataā€: [
    23,
    107
    ]
    }

  • 2025-04-17T22:12:49.737Z
    Frequency 59.95 is not valid

  • 2025-04-17T22:12:49.739Z
    Returned null.

Checking register 524 for grid frequency:

  • 2025-04-17T22:12:49.741Z
    send_request: start = 524, end = 524, fc = 3

  • 2025-04-17T22:12:49.904Z
    No MODBUS data to process data

  • 2025-04-17T22:12:49.908Z
    Returned null.

Checking register 33282 for grid frequency:

  • 2025-04-17T22:12:49.909Z
    send_request: start = 33282, end = 33282, fc = 3

  • 2025-04-17T22:12:50.136Z
    No MODBUS data to process data

  • 2025-04-17T22:12:50.140Z
    Returned null.

Checking register 33282 for grid frequency:

  • 2025-04-17T22:12:50.142Z
    send_request: start = 609, end = 609, fc = 3

  • 2025-04-17T22:12:50.350Z
    No MODBUS data to process data

  • 2025-04-17T22:12:50.354Z
    Returned null.

No suitable inverters found

I have published a new test version that fixes a silly mistake with the range checking.

Hi @Adrian_Rockall ,
1.1.29 accept now 60hz +/- and i could install the 4 devices.
The app seem not to receive the voltage.
Br

Which voltage?
I can see the grid voltage, the PV voltages and the battery voltage in the log.

@Adrian_Rockall
sorry, i meant the battery voltage…and the inverter status.

BR

@Adrian_Rockall how the add this widget please ?

If you mean the dashboard widget, then open the dashboard, select the edit :pen:, tap on the +, then select the Apps tab and find the Sofar widget. In the customise screen select the devices for each category and save it. Finally click on Done.

@Adrian_Rockall
Sorry to make your precious time lost, i have found dashboard/widget on fone; i were looking for it on PC webpage. i could instal your sofar widget and it’s marvellous.

Unfortunately, Athom haven’t made dashboards work with the web app, which is very disappointing.

And no Windows desktop app neither

Grazie per l’app prima di tutto, vorrei chiedere se ci fosse una possibilitĆ  di escludere i valori fuori scala. nel mio insight trovo (forse a causa della connessione del logger con il wifi o altro) dei valori completamente errati che rovinano le statistiche. vedi allegato.
grazie.

It’s difficult to know what are bad values. I could put a setting for a limit.

I understand, actually setting some parameter ceiling could eliminate a lot of the problem Maybe even a value discard time setting. thanks for the support.

Hi, i have installed version 1.1.29 today and my app stop working.

  • 2025-05-12T17:33:21.391Z
    Found Inverter: IP: 192.168.1.133, S.No: 2734238489

  • 2025-05-12T17:33:21.398Z
    Checking register 14 for grid frequency:

  • 2025-05-12T17:33:26.515Z
    Returned null.

Checking register 1156 for grid frequency:

  • 2025-05-12T17:33:30.352Z
    Frequency 49.94 is good

  • 2025-05-12T17:33:30.357Z
    Found inverter

  • 2025-05-12T17:33:39.443Z
    Missing one or more of Frequency = 49.96, Consumption = 0, Grid_Voltage = 239, Total_Import = 0

  • 2025-05-12T17:33:52.116Z
    Missing one or more of Frequency = 49.95, Consumption = 0, Grid_Voltage = 239, Total_Import = 0

  • 2025-05-12T17:34:04.824Z
    Missing one or more of Frequency = 49.99, Consumption = 0, Grid_Voltage = 239.3, Total_Import = 0

  • 2025-05-12T17:34:17.361Z
    Missing one or more of Frequency = 49.99, Consumption = 0, Grid_Voltage = 239.3, Total_Import = 0

  • 2025-05-12T17:34:29.740Z
    Missing one or more of Frequency = 50.01, Consumption = 0, Grid_Voltage = 239.10000000000002, Total_Import = 0

  • 2025-05-12T17:34:55.932Z
    Missing one or more of Frequency = 49.97, Consumption = 0, Grid_Voltage = 239.4, Total_Import = 0

  • 2025-05-12T17:35:08.249Z
    Missing one or more of Frequency = 49.96, Consumption = 0, Grid_Voltage = 239.60000000000002, Total_Import = 0

  • 2025-05-12T17:35:22.973Z
    Missing one or more of Frequency = 49.97, Consumption = 0, Grid_Voltage = 239.3, Total_Import = 0

  • 2025-05-12T17:35:37.581Z
    Missing one or more of Frequency = 49.93, Consumption = 0, Grid_Voltage = 238.70000000000002, Total_Import = 0

  • 2025-05-12T17:35:54.120Z
    Missing one or more of Frequency = 49.95, Consumption = 0, Grid_Voltage = 239.10000000000002, Total_Import = 0

  • 2025-05-12T17:36:17.011Z
    Missing one or more of Frequency = 49.97, Consumption = 0, Grid_Voltage = 239.10000000000002, Total_Import = 0

@Adrian_Rockall Thanks to your work we’ve been using your app for over a year.

About 6 days ago, the app lost contact with our inverter (but the inverter is posting readings to sofarman online. The app icon does not show offline, just 0 in the power readings, also the logger is 6 days old.

How to debug this?
e2039dcd-a124-43f7-9566-e677e8b32f41